When you book a room using Marriott points at properties like NYNY or the Cosmopolitan (Cosmo), you are still responsible for taxes and resort fees. Even though the room itself is comped through your points redemption, resort fees are typically not covered by points and must be paid separately. These fees can include amenities such as Wi-Fi, gym access, and others, and they are charged on a per-night basis.
